Jagdeep Dhankhar resigned while Vice President of India called health reasons on July 21.

However, the opposition guided by the Congrest Party has rejected the explanation of medical issues behind the abrupt movement of the 74-year-old, and claims instead that 'many deeper reasons' play.

The resignation came on the first day of the monsoon session of parliament. Dhankhar had a day full of action in the house of the elderly, as the Rajya Sabha is called before he resigns.

Declaration sponsored by the opposition

In the midst of the criticism, a decision to initiate a notification sponsored by the opposition to accusation against Justice Yashwant Varma, coupled with the dismissal of Dhankhar.

Dhankhar takes the notification of accusation against Justice Varma of the opposition as chairman of the Rajya Sabha reportedly not good with the government. Instead of including the notification in the Rajya Sabha, the government wanted it to be initiated in the Lokha, according to reports in the media, including the Indian Express and the Hindustan Times.

However, there is no official word about this reasoning.

The congress had started collecting signatures two weeks ago, shortly after the notification of three pages of the internal investigation that the then Chief Justice of India Sanjiv Khanna had ordered against Justice Varma, according to a report in Deccan Herald. The notification has the details of the sequence of events, grounds for removal, violation of the public trust and probability and recommendation for removal.

Read also | Watch viral video: what Jagdeep Dhankhar said about his retirement ten days ago

However, the characteristic collection picked up on July 20 Momentum to collect at least 50 signatures – the minimum needed to move a motion in the Rajya Sabha – to initiate the removal of Justice Varma, the Indian Express said.

The government saw this as the movement of the opposition to undermine her own motion on Justice Varma in the Lok Sabha. The government had already collected signatures on the issue in the Lok Sabha, where the minimum requirement for a motion of accusation is 100 signatures. The motion can be moved in both house.

The opposition did not want the reigning NDA to walk away with the anti-corruption board about this. The Indian Express report said it also wanted to raise the issue of Justice Shekhar Yadav, whose removal was sought for controversial comments during a VHP event, together with that of Justice Varma.

Justice Varma Cash-At-Home Case

On March 15, firefighters called to the Justice Varma Bungalow in Central Delhi, discovered piles of burned money.

Justice Varma has denied every link to the money and referred to the accusations of inappropriateness against him and members of his family “ridiculous”.

The Supreme Court has set up an internal panel that has recommended the accusation of Justice Yashwant Varma. The report was forwarded to President Droupadi Murmu and Prime Minister Narendra Modi – by that time CJI Khanna.
